Description
This property has been lovingly cared for and improved over the years and has provided a wonderful family home. The property once formed part of a working farm and was the main farmhouse. It was redeveloped to an exceptionally high standard througout and maintains many original features, including many beams and original quarry floor to the main entrance hall.
The current owners had the forsight to invest heavily and the property benefits from an Air Source Heat Pump and Solar Panels keeping costs to a very minimum.
This spacious four bedroom home offers plenty of living space arranged over two floors and there is scope to create a separate annex to the ground floor if you are looking to provide separate living for a relative or just want a separation when guests are staying.
Upon entering you suddently appreciate the expanse the property affords. The fabulously large farmhouse kitchen is the ideal space for entertaining. The current owners have enjoyed many a family get together in this wonderful space. It is a cook's paradise in terms of worktop space and there is ample storage throughout. With high vaulted ceiling and exposed timber this really is the heart of this wonderful home. Doors lead out on to the first of two patio areas and benefits from being extremely private and south facing.
The accommodation to the ground floor can be flexible to suit the new owners needs. It consists of entrance hall with quarry tiling, two reception rooms, one with woodburning stove which provides a further source of constant heat for the property. There is a large kitchen/diner with vaulted ceilings, cream shaker style units to the wall and base with integrated appliances and granite worktops. There is a utility room accessed immediately from the kitchen area and downstairs wc off of the kitchen. To the other end of the house you will find one of four bedrooms which has access to the garden, there is a separate walk in wardrobe and spacious shower room.
Upstairs the master bedroom sits to one end of the property maintaining privacy and has fitted wardrobes to both sides. The remaining bedrooms lie at the other end of the house, all have fitted wardrobes, bedroom four benefits from a hidden walk in wardrobe cleverly hidden behind a secret door. The owners have made what was redundant space in to a very useful addition. A large shower room with underfloor heating completes the overall accommodation.
The spacious south facing garden is mainly laid to lawn. There is a large area for vegetables and a wonderful further patio area placed to enjoy those long lazy days in the sun.
There is a purpose built timber framed carport with parking for two cars and one further space with doors. This comes with electric. The gravelled driveway has sufficient space for up to three cars.

Owthorpe is a small hamlet with lots of beautiful surrounding countryside. It lies just down the road from the neighbouring village of Kinoulton which has a highly regarded primary school, a popular local village pub and access to the grantham canal and many lovely walks in to the country. Cotgrave and Cropwell Bishop are a short drive away where you will find many other amenities and there is easy access to A52, A46, A607 making transport links easy and accessible.
